America's $38 trillion national debt is increasing at over $70,000 per second. To stop the growing debt crisis, Congress must enact real change, not merely uphold the status quo. While I recognize that the process of righting our national budget will come with growing pains, we must remember Thomas Jefferson's warning that "public debt [is] the greatest of the dangers to be feared."

If we wish to survive as a nation and preserve the Republic for our children and grandchildren, Congress must stop spending money we do not have and work to eliminate the waste, fraud, and abuse currently found within the federal government.
